Fork me on GitHub

目前已装的包管理工具

NVM - 0.33.11

Node Version Manager

安装方式
1
cur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.33.11/install.sh | bash
安装地址
1
.nvm
配置

.zshrc或者.bash_profile中添加下面内容

1
2
3
export NVM_DIR="$HOME/.nvm"
[ -s "$NVM_DIR/nvm.sh" ] && \. "$NVM_DIR/nvm.sh" # This loads nvm
[ -s "$NVM_DIR/bash_completion" ] && \. "$NVM_DIR/bash_completion" # This loads nvm bash_completion

平时如果用不到的话建议注释掉,因为加上会导致 iTerm 打开很慢。

NPM - 6.4.1

通常称为 node 包管理器,是目前世界上最大的开源库生态系统。使用 NPM 可以对 node 包进行安装、卸载、更新、查看、搜索、发布等操作。先安装Node后就自带npm了

安装地址
1
2
3
4
5
$ which npm

/Users/joy/.nvm/versions/node/v11.2.0/bin/npm

/Users/joy/.nvm/versions/node/v11.2.0/lib/node_modules/npm

Node.js - v11.2.0

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。
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型,使其轻量又高效。

安装方式
1
2
# 使用nvm安装
nvm install node
安装地址
1
2
3
4
5
$ which node

/Users/joy/.nvm/versions/node/v11.2.0/bin/node

/Users/joy/.nvm/versions/node/v11.2.0/include/node

Hexo - 1.1.0

安装方式
1
2
3
4
npm install -g hexo-cli

# 卸载
npm uninstall hexo-cli -g
安装地址
1
2
3
/Users/joy/.nvm/versions/node/v11.2.0/bin/hexo

/Users/joy/.nvm/versions/node/v11.2.0/lib/node_modules/hexo-cli

CocoaPod - 1.4.0

通过gem安装,iOS第三方库管理工具

Carthage - 0.31.1

通过Brew安装,iOS第三方库管理工具

HomeBrew - 1.9.1

macOS 缺失的软件包的管理器

gem(RubyGems) - 2.7.6

RubyGems是一个包管理框架,提供了ruby社区gem的托管服务,用于方便地下载、安装和使用ruby软件包。ruby软件包被称为gem,包含了ruby应用或库。

ruby - 2.3.7p456 (2018-03-28 revision 63024)

anaconda

  • tensorflow - 1.9.0
-------------本文结束感谢您的阅读-------------

本文作者:乔羽 / FightingJoey

发布时间:2018年11月16日 - 11:25

最后更新:2018年11月16日 - 19:49

原始链接:https://fightingjoey.github.io/2018/11/16/记录/目前已装的包管理工具/

许可协议: 署名-非商业性使用-禁止演绎 4.0 国际 转载请保留原文链接及作者。

坚持原创技术分享,您的支持将鼓励我继续创作!